US defense spending bill shifts Israel funds from Iron Dome
US defence funds to Israel will be concentrating on countering ballistic missiles
The 2026 National Defense Authorization Act keeps overall U.S.-Israel missile defense cooperation spending at $200 million, consistent with 2025 expenditures.
The House of Representatives released its proposal for 2026 defense spending that would see a $50 million shift in funds for Israel from countering short-range rockets and mortars to systems that intercept ballistic missiles.
The 2026 National Defense Authorization Act, released on Sunday, would spend $60 million on the U.S.-Israeli co-development and production program for Iron Dome, down from $110 million in 2025.
